Brief Life History of Naomi

Naomi Cardwell was born about 1723, in New York Colony, British Colonial America. She married James Newberry in 1745, in Groton, New London, Connecticut Colony, British Colonial America. They were the parents of at least 2 daughters.

    Name Meaning

    English and Scottish: in northern England, the West Midlands, and southwest Scotland, this surname is a variant of Caldwell . In southwestern England it is probably a variant of Cardall, a habitational name from Cardwell in Milton Abbot (Devon). See also Cardell .

    Dictionary of American Family Names © Patrick Hanks 2003, 2006.
